Most resolutions are stated in terms of what we'll lose, give up, or stop doing. There's a certain negative connotation within the resolution (such as, needing to lose weight or quit something.)
How about setting a goal that has to do with an action? Like what you want to be able to do, or be... not about losing, but about gaining something for yourself.
If you want to stop smoking, you could state your goal like this: "I am making healthy choices for myself every moment of every day."
If you want to lose weight and plan to go to the gym - state goals that are about what you want to accomplish with your body - how much weight do you want to lift? How fast do you want to run the mile?
And, HOW will you feel when you've accomplished your goal? -- start feeling that way NOW.
'Begin at the end' refers to feeling the way you'll feel when you've reached your goal.
